Weather & Climate in Cardston, AB

Temperature, precipitation, air quality, natural hazards, and monthly weather data.

Cardston has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 45°F (7°C). Winters average 27°F in January while summers reach 68°F in July. The area gets 288 sunny days per year, well above the U.S. average of 205 / making it one of the sunnier locations in the country. Annual precipitation totals 15.1 inches (drier than the 38-inch national average). The area receives 38.1 inches of snow annually, a moderate snowfall amount.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 27 / among the cleanest air in the country. 90% of days have good air quality. The city sits at an elevation of 3,737 feet.

Monthly Weather

Month Avg Temperature Precipitation Summary
January 27°F (-3°C) 0.8 in
February 24°F (-4°C) 0.8 in Driest
March 31°F (-0°C) 1.3 in
April 41°F (5°C) 1.5 in
May 51°F (10°C) 2.8 in
June 58°F (14°C) 3.5 in Wettest
July 68°F (20°C) 1.5 in Warmest
August 62°F (17°C) 1.7 in
September 53°F (12°C) 2.0 in
October 44°F (7°C) 1.1 in
November 30°F (-1°C) 0.9 in
December 22°F (-6°C) 0.8 in Coldest

Cardston has a seasonal temperature swing of 45°F / from 22°F in December to 68°F in July. Total annual precipitation is 18.7 inches, with June being the wettest month (3.5") and February the driest (0.8").
